Peacefully set in the neighborhood of Nampa, ID, Family Life Memory Care is a nurturing senior living community, offering specialized memory care services to residents dealing with any forms of memory loss. The community provides each resident with comfortable and secure accommodations with wheelchair accessible showers for residents with mobility issues. Residents also enjoy the comfort and convenience provided by having a reliable care team available at all times to offer extensive care and support tailored to individual needs and preferences.
The community carefully curates an array of activities that are designed to provide residents the stimulation, enrichment, and interactions they need to live a fulfilling and rewarding retirement experience. Residents here also enjoy meticulously prepared meals for their daily nourishment, giving them the energy they need to stay active throughout the day. Here, residents can fully enjoy their golden years despite their afflictions with the right amount of care and support.

Family Life Memory Care is legally operated by Family Life, LLC, and administrated by Avalos Carry.
In Idaho, the Department of Health and Welfare, Bureau of Facility Standards is the state agency tasked with inspecting and licensing assisted living and nursing home facilities.

The most recent inspection on April 3, 2024, found deficiencies related to medication refrigerator temperature monitoring, psychotropic medication reviews, and staff training for traumatic brain injury. Earlier inspections showed a pattern of issues including fire and life safety code compliance, emergency preparedness, nursing assessments, staff scheduling, and certification requirements. The main themes across reports involved medication management, staff training, and safety documentation. No fines, immediate jeopardy findings, or enforcement actions were listed in the available reports, and complaint investigations were not noted. The facility’s deficiencies appear consistent over time without a clear trend of improvement or worsening.
